Westminster Men's Soccer Earns First Conference Win

CARLINVILLE, Ill. - Westminster men's soccer gets back to winnings ways with its first conference win over Blackburn, 4-0.

The Blue Jays improve their record to 2-6-1 and 1-0 in the St. Louis Intercollegiate Athletic Conference. 

"We had a great result and a great start to conference play today," said Westminster Head Coach Adam Galla. "We did a really good job in the final third, creating quality opportunity and finishing them. We are starting to find a nice rhythm and we'll be ready for Greenville on Wednesday." 

Cade Rowlette struck first in the 20th minute on an assist from Brandon Rettke

It wasn't long until the Blue Jays scored again, just seven minutes later, when Daniel Barone scored on an assist from Mauricio Matteo. 

Westminster kept pouring on the offensive attack in the first half, scoring their third goal from Patrick Wisnewski on an assist from Philip Udinyiwe. 

The Beavers added a goal in the 86th minute, but Cooper Smith scored his first goal of the season to keep the win for the Blue Jays.

The Blue Jays outshot Westminster 12-5. Connor Bandre played all 90 minutes in goal and made two saves. 

Westminster goes on to face Greenville Wednesday at home.
